Tryptophan, an amino acid that promotes serotonin production. Serotonin is a hormone that helps regulate your sleep. Your body can't produce tryptophan on its own — it has to be obtained through your diet. Good sources: turkey, chicken, fish, eggs, cheese, edamame, peanuts, tofu, quinoa and pumpkin seeds.What is the best thing to eat at 10pm?

Does popcorn help you sleep?
Popcorn is a whole grain packed with fiber and carbs. Carbohydrates make tryptophan, an amino acid important for sleep, more available to the brain. A study found that food such as popcorn and nuts provided a longer sleep duration than food such as burgers and pizza. Here's another sweet bedtime treat.What can I eat at night to not gain weight?

What is the 20 minute rule for eating?
The 20-minute rule, which is used to avoid overeating, is based on the physiological fact that it takes your brain about 20 minutes after you start eating to feel full. This suggests that if you eat too quickly, you might consume more food than your body needs before you feel satisfied.What is the 80/20 rule sleep?
